4GB DDR4 2400 ECC UDIMM module
This single-rank 4GB DDR4 2400 module runs at CL17 with a standard 1.20V supply. It uses unbuffered ECC UDIMM architecture on a 288-pin form factor for server and workstation platforms.
1Rx8 Major Brand Chipset layout
The 1Rx8 organisation with Major Brand Chipset components delivers registered-grade error correction without the buffering overhead. Quality-assurance testing on every stick targets dependable operation under sustained multi-tasking workloads.
Suited for Dell A9652461 slot upgrades
Builders expanding a compatible Dell server or workstation gain ECC protection at DDR4 2400 speeds. Systems requiring registered DIMMs, higher capacities per slot, or faster DDR4 data rates should look at something else.
